Summary

Significance of the Topic


Liquid chromatography remains a cornerstone of modern analytical chemistry, enabling precise separation and quantification of complex mixtures across pharmaceutical, environmental and food safety laboratories. Affordable, compact systems with robust performance are increasingly sought after by small to medium-sized labs tasked with routine analyses under stringent regulatory requirements. The Agilent 1220 Infinity II LC addresses this need by combining high reproducibility, flexible configurations and a low footprint to maximize return on investment and support critical workflows.

Methodology and Used Instrumentation


  • Pump Module: Isocratic or gradient pump with integrated dual-channel vacuum degasser, delivering stable, pulse-free flow up to 10 mL/min and pressures to 600 bar for sub-2 μm and core-shell column compatibility.
  • Columns: InfinityLab Poroshell 120 EC-18, 3 × 50 mm, 2.7 μm core-shell columns offering fast, high-resolution separations under high pressure.
  • Detectors: Variable wavelength detector (VWD) with low baseline drift, wide linear range and 80 Hz data rate; diode array detector (DAD) for spectral confirmation at up to 8 wavelengths and flow cells from 2–13 µL.
  • Autosampler and Injector: Integrated autosampler with 0.1–100 μL injection volume, full- or half-size vials trays; manual injector option with ceramic rotor valve and up to 5 mL loop capacity.
  • Column Oven: Temperature control up to 80 °C for method reproducibility.
  • Software: Agilent OpenLAB CDS for instrument control, data acquisition, audit-ready traceability and advanced reporting.

Main Results and Discussion


  • Reproducibility: Nine overlaid pesticide peaks exhibited retention time RSD < 0.15 % across six consecutive injections under fast gradient at 563 bar, demonstrating run-after-run precision.
  • Detection Limits: Variable wavelength detection of trace pesticide residues achieved LOD < 50 pg with area RSD < 0.5 %, supporting trace-level quantification.
  • Baseline Stability: Continuous vacuum degassing and low internal volume (<1.5 mL/channel) eliminated baseline fluctuations and reduced equilibration time.
  • Robust Connections: InfinityLab Quick Connect fittings provided zero dead volume, leak-tight performance over hundreds of re-connections.

Benefits and Practical Applications


  • Affordability and Footprint: Entry-level system that meets regulatory demands in a compact benchtop package.
  • Flexibility: Seamless integration with other InfinityLab LC Series modules (FLD, RID, ELSD, MS) for broad application coverage.
  • Upgrade Path: Modular upgrades to gradient pumps, autosampler, column ovens and detectors protect investment and enable future method development.
  • Workflow Solutions: Walk-up mode allows multi-user access via external sample trays and guided software; mobile LC configuration supports field testing of environmental, food and pharmaceutical samples.
